Ejector Pump Installation in Huntsville, AL
Ejector pump installation services provide an effective solution for managing wastewater and sewage in properties where gravity drainage is insufficient. These systems are designed to pump waste from lower levels, such as basements or below-grade bathrooms, to the main sewer line or septic system. Projects typically involve installing ejector pumps in new construction or upgrading existing systems to improve reliability and performance. Homeowners often seek this service when adding a bathroom or laundry room below the sewer line, or when existing drainage systems experience backups or inefficiencies.
Before requesting ejector pump installation, property owners should understand the specific requirements of their plumbing setup and the capacity needed for their household. It’s important to consider the size of the property, the number of fixtures, and the type of waste being handled. Proper planning ensures the selected system can handle current needs and potential future expansions. Consulting with a professional can help determine the appropriate type and placement of the ejector pump, ensuring it functions effectively within the existing plumbing infrastructure.

Ejector Pump Installation Questions
What is an ejector pump used for? An ejector pump helps remove wastewater from basement bathrooms, laundry rooms, or other areas below the main sewer line, preventing backups and flooding.
How does an ejector pump installation work? The installation involves placing the pump in a basin below the level of the drain, connecting it to the plumbing system, and ensuring proper venting for reliable operation.
What types of properties typically need ejector pump services? Ejector pumps are commonly installed in homes with basement bathrooms, laundry areas, or any below-grade plumbing fixtures requiring drainage assistance.
What should property owners know before installing an ejector pump? Proper sizing, correct placement, and adherence to local plumbing codes are important for effective and safe operation of the ejector pump system.
